## Changelog — Quillgauge Sidecar v2.8.0

**Renamed:** `QG_PUSH_TOKEN` is now `QG_INGEST_CREDENTIAL`. The old name implied the sidecar pushed metrics on its own schedule, but since v2.6 it responds to pull requests from the Lanternmoor aggregator, so the name was misleading. Both names are accepted until v3.0; a deprecation warning is logged once per boot if the old key is present. Reviewers should confirm the fallback path in `config/resolve.go` checks the new name first. A correct `.env` now contains exactly one credential line, shown below.

secret setting of bageg-yahif: VAULT_KEY29=d4ce950960c6149c93c44ba30eb69

Runbook 7.2 — Account Recovery, Gridlane Autocomplete Widget. If a merchant on Pellworth Commerce loses access to the address autocomplete admin panel, first verify their tenant record in the Gridlane console and confirm the widget license is active. Then initiate recovery from the escrow console, logging the request carefully. Enter the recovery passphrase exactly as shown below.

strongbox words: sorir-belvan-rusix-ulays-ralmir-praix-eliir-tamax-praael-druael-julir-tamius-jorir

## Authentication

Plugins for ScrubLens authenticate against the Metaplate internal API before submitting EXIF-scrubbing jobs. Each plugin instance must present a key on every request via the standard auth header; sessions are not supported. Keys are scoped to the sandbox tier by default, which limits you to 200 images per hour and strips GPS, serial, and lens metadata only. Production-tier scopes are granted after review by the Fernwood Labs plugin team. For local testing against the shared sandbox, use the key below.

gateway credential: kto3_qfe

Checklist item 7 — Spoketide rebalancer. Before cutting the release, run a dry-run rebalance against the Calderon Bay sandbox and eyeball the truck-routing output; last time it tried to move forty bikes to a dock with twelve slots. If the plan looks sane, tag the build and note it in the changelog. Stamp the release notes with the token below.

build token for tawip-yageg: htk9_92ac43d42